The Section of Archaeology at the State Museum will be conducting their excavation at Fort Hunter Mansion and Park between September 4 and October 4, 2019. Every fall since 2006, the Archaeology Section of the State Museum of Pennsylvania has led a month-long excavation at Fort Hunter Mansion and Park in Harrisburg, PA. Come out and see what we find this year! Artifacts will be on display and archaeologists will be on hand Monday-Friday, 9:30 am- 4:00 pm, weather permitting, to answer questions about the site and how field archaeology is conducted. This is a great opportunity to visit an archaeological site and experienced volunteers are always appreciated.
